The Māori All Blacks have a rich rugby history beginning with their first match played in the city more than 100 years ago.

Fiji will be using this match as a launching pad for their Rugby World Cup campaign and are guaranteed to bring their firebrand style and flair to the game.

Meanwhile, the fired-up Māori All Blacks side will be looking to avenge the loss they suffered against the British and Irish Lions when they last played Rotorua in 2017.

The game is being held at Rotorua International Stadium on July 20; gates open at 4.30pm with the U20's Māori All Blacks and U20s Fiji Rugby sides playing the curtain raiser from 5pm.
